Output 3330dac6c6812382f5a72dae90b9a81a69c60d9efa5000c2d5d41f1283e4d003:1

value
1143229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d6125dddcab500cd35c203f1d2c095a369ec34c OP_EQUAL
address
3LQxppn754X6uU4xSmRqcHLbsTFjjA8jwi
transaction
3330dac6c6812382f5a72dae90b9a81a69c60d9efa5000c2d5d41f1283e4d003
spent
true